Topping-out ceremony marks progress on Bluffton medical office building

BLUFFTON, S.C. (May 27, 2025) –MUSC Health leaders gathered today with teams from Frampton Construction, The Keith Corporation and Novus Architects at a topping-out ceremony to celebrate a significant milestone for the future MUSC Health Bluffton Medical Pavilion. Once complete, the medical office space will provide increased access to care for those in the surrounding communities and bring medical specialties closer to home. The topping-out event involved placement of the structure’s final steel beam atop the building to mark the completion of the facility’s structural phase.

The three-story 54,000-square-foot medical office building will be located at 700 Buckwalter Towne Blvd. The new facility will consolidate existing services in the Bluffton area into one location and provide new specialties for the community. The new services to be provided include:

  • Adult and pediatric primary care.
  • A Hollings Cancer Center satellite clinic (oncology and infusion services with supporting lab and compounding pharmacy).
  • Pediatric specialty and urgent care (after hours).
  • Phlebotomy.
  • Pulmonary/Sleep lab.
  • Vascular care.

The MUSC Health Bluffton Medical Pavilion project is on schedule and expected to open in spring 2026. For more information about this project, please visit MUSCHealth.org/BMP.

About MUSC

Founded in 1824 in Charleston, MUSC is the state’s only comprehensive academic health system, with a mission to preserve and optimize human life in South Carolina through education, research and patient care. Each year, MUSC educates over 3,100 students in six colleges and trains 950+ residents and fellows across its health system. MUSC leads the state in federal and National Institutes of Health and research funding. For information on our academic programs, visitmusc.edu.

As the health care system of the Medical University of South Carolina, MUSC Health is dedicated to delivering the highest-quality and safest patient care while educating and training generations of outstanding health care providers and leaders to serve the people of South Carolina and beyond. In 2024, for the 10th consecutive year, U.S. News & World Report named MUSC Health University Medical Center in Charleston the No. 1 hospital in South Carolina.
